def get_links(self, obj=None, lookup_field="pk"): request = self.context.get("request", None) view = self.context.get("view", None) return_data = OrderedDict() kwargs = { lookup_field: getattr(obj, lookup_field) if obj else view.kwargs[lookup_field] } field_name = self.field_name if self.field_name else self.parent.field_name self_kwargs = kwargs.copy() self_kwargs.update({"related_field": format_link_segment(field_name)}) self_link = self.get_url("self", self.self_link_view_name, self_kwargs, request) # Assuming RelatedField will be declared in two ways: # 1. url(r'^authors/(?P<pk>[^/.]+)/(?P<related_field>\w+)/$', # AuthorViewSet.as_view({'get': 'retrieve_related'})) # 2. url(r'^authors/(?P<author_pk>[^/.]+)/bio/$', # AuthorBioViewSet.as_view({'get': 'retrieve'})) # So, if related_link_url_kwarg == 'pk' it will add 'related_field' parameter to reverse() if self.related_link_url_kwarg == "pk": related_kwargs = self_kwargs else: related_kwargs = { self.related_link_url_kwarg: kwargs[self.related_link_lookup_field] } related_link = self.get_url("related", self.related_link_view_name, related_kwargs, request) if self_link: return_data.update({"self": self_link}) if related_link: return_data.update({"related": related_link}) return return_data
